Understanding Your Track Motor: The Heart of Your Machine
Alright, before we get our hands dirty, let's chat about what a track motor actually is. Think of it as the powerhouse that drives your heavy machinery's tracks. It's the unsung hero that allows your excavator, bulldozer, or any other track-equipped equipment to move across the terrain. These motors are typically hydraulic or electric, converting power into the rotational force needed to move those tracks. The track motor is essential for mobility and performance, making it a critical component for all your machinery's operation. When things go south with your track motor, your work grinds to a halt. Recognizing the signs of trouble early on can save you time, money, and a whole lot of frustration. If the tracks are not functioning properly, then the track motor is the first thing that you should examine.
Now, let's talk about the various types of track motors. Hydraulic track motors are the most common. They use hydraulic fluid, pressurized by a hydraulic pump, to create the rotational force. These motors are known for their high torque and robust performance, making them ideal for heavy-duty applications. Electric track motors, on the other hand, are gaining popularity, especially in smaller equipment. They offer a cleaner and more efficient alternative, with the ability to provide instant torque. But, regardless of the type, all track motors share a common enemy: wear and tear. Constant use, exposure to harsh environments, and the sheer force they endure take a toll, eventually leading to malfunctions. Regular maintenance and a keen eye for potential problems are crucial in extending the life of your track motor and preventing costly repairs. Get familiar with the main components like the housing, the gears, and the seals. This basic knowledge will come in handy when troubleshooting and repairing your track motor.
Common Track Motor Problems: Spotting the Trouble
So, your equipment is acting up, and you suspect the track motor is the culprit. What should you be looking for? Identifying the symptoms is the first step toward a successful track motor repair. The most obvious sign is a complete loss of track movement. If one or both tracks refuse to budge, your track motor is likely the problem. But it's not always this clear-cut. Sometimes, the issue manifests as sluggish track movement, where the tracks move slowly or with reduced power. This can be caused by a variety of issues, including low hydraulic fluid pressure or worn internal components. Another telltale sign is unusual noises. Grinding, squealing, or knocking sounds coming from the track motor area are red flags that warrant immediate attention. These noises often indicate that gears are worn, bearings are damaged, or debris has found its way inside the motor. Leaks are also a major concern. If you spot hydraulic fluid leaking from the track motor, it's a clear indication of a seal failure or a cracked housing. Leaks not only lead to a loss of hydraulic pressure but also allow contaminants to enter the motor, causing further damage.
Another common issue is overheating. Track motors generate a lot of heat, but excessive heat can be a sign of internal friction or a blockage. If your track motor is consistently running hot, it's time to investigate the cause. Finally, don't ignore any changes in the track motor's performance. Has the machine's turning radius become wider? Does it struggle to climb inclines? These subtle changes can indicate a problem with the track motor, even if there are no obvious symptoms. Pay attention to how your equipment operates and address any issues promptly. Early detection is key to preventing minor problems from escalating into major repairs. Also, remember to visually inspect the track motor regularly. Look for any signs of damage, such as dents, cracks, or loose components. Check the hydraulic lines and fittings for leaks. A proactive approach to maintenance will save you time and money.
Troubleshooting Your Track Motor: A Step-by-Step Guide
Alright, let's get down to the nitty-gritty of track motor repair. Before you start taking things apart, safety first, always. Disconnect the battery or use a lockout/tagout procedure to ensure the machine can't accidentally start. Now, let's walk through a basic troubleshooting process. First, perform a visual inspection. Look for obvious signs of damage, such as leaks, dents, or loose components. Check the hydraulic lines and fittings for any signs of damage or leaks. Next, check the hydraulic fluid level. Low fluid levels can cause a variety of problems, including reduced power and overheating. If the fluid level is low, top it off and inspect the system for leaks. If a leak is found, repair it before proceeding. Then, check the hydraulic pressure. Use a pressure gauge to measure the hydraulic pressure at the track motor. Compare the readings to the manufacturer's specifications. If the pressure is too low, there could be a problem with the hydraulic pump, valves, or the track motor itself. If the pressure is low, then try to change the oil for the track motor.
If the pressure is within spec, move on to the next step. Listen for unusual noises. As we mentioned earlier, grinding, squealing, or knocking sounds can indicate internal problems. Try operating the track motor while listening carefully for these noises. Where did the noise come from? The sound can indicate the position of the problem. If the noise can be heard more by the left track, then the problem is more likely on that side. If the track motor is making any unusual noises, then it's time to disassemble the motor for a closer inspection. If all of the above checks are negative, then it's time to start thinking about internal issues. Disassembly is a step-by-step process. Take photos of the motor before you start taking it apart to ensure you remember the order of the parts. Then, remove the motor from the machine and disassemble it carefully. Note the position of all parts. Inspect all internal components, including gears, bearings, and seals. Look for any signs of wear, damage, or contamination. If you find any damaged components, replace them. Reassemble the motor, following the manufacturer's instructions. Replace all seals and O-rings during reassembly. Then, test the motor to make sure it functions properly.

Maintaining Your Track Motor: Preventing Future Problems
Okay, so you've repaired your track motor. But the job doesn't end there! Regular maintenance is key to extending the life of your track motor and preventing future problems. So, what can you do to keep your track motor in tip-top shape? The first and most important thing is to follow the manufacturer's recommended maintenance schedule. This typically involves regular inspections, fluid changes, and lubrication. Check your track motor regularly for leaks, damage, and unusual noises. Pay close attention to the hydraulic fluid level and top it off as needed. Also, regularly check the hydraulic fluid for contamination. Contaminants can damage internal components and reduce the motor's lifespan. To protect the track motor, you should regularly change the hydraulic filter. A clean filter will help prevent contaminants from entering the system. The hydraulic fluid should also be changed as specified by the manufacturer.
Also, lubricate the track motor as recommended. Proper lubrication reduces friction and wear, extending the life of the motor. Also, avoid overloading your equipment. Overloading puts excessive stress on the track motor and other components, leading to premature wear and failure. Finally, operate your equipment in a way that minimizes stress on the track motor. Avoid sharp turns, sudden starts and stops, and operating in extremely harsh conditions. Also, clean your equipment after each use. Dirt, debris, and other contaminants can damage the track motor. Washing down your equipment regularly will help to keep it clean and prevent problems. A well-maintained track motor will provide years of reliable service, so make maintenance a priority. By following these simple tips, you can extend the life of your track motor and minimize the risk of costly repairs.
